President: ‘Our energy projects will continue to ensure energy security of many countries’
Foreign policy
- 16 March, 2024
- 12:25
“We are well aware of the dynamics of the global energy markets. It's evident that the demand for Azerbaijani gas will continue to rise each year in the European continent,” President Ilham Aliyev said in a joint press conference with the Prime Minister of Georgia, Irakli Kobakhidze, Report informs, citing AZERTAC.
Highlighting Azerbaijan`s resources, financial capabilities, reliable friends like Georgia, and extensive transit opportunities, the head of state noted: "In such a scenario, our energy projects will play a pivotal role in ensuring the energy security of numerous countries. Georgia and Azerbaijan stand as reliable partners in this endeavor."
